What a car wash leaves behind
An automatic wash rinses loose dirt and adds swirl marks. Exterior detailing removes what stays bonded to the paint — iron fallout, tar, overspray, and hard-water minerals baked in by Texas heat.
Once the surface is genuinely clean, we protect it. Clean paint without protection is just paint that gets dirty again faster.

The process
How the appointment runs
- Step 1
Setup
We arrive with water and power, shade the work area where possible, and inspect the paint.
- Step 2
Wash
Pre-rinse, foam, wheels first, then a careful two-bucket contact wash top to bottom.
- Step 3
Decon
Iron, tar, and clay as needed so the surface is smooth before any protection goes on.
- Step 4
Protect
Dry with plush microfiber, apply wax or sealant, dress tires and trim, final walkaround.






Frequently asked questions
Is this different from a car wash?
Completely. A wash rinses the surface. Exterior detailing decontaminates the paint, cleans the wheels properly, and finishes with protection.
Do you clay the paint?
When it's needed. Clay lifts bonded contaminants a wash can't. Very fresh paint sometimes doesn't need it.
How long does the protection last?
Wax lasts weeks to a few months. A synthetic sealant typically holds several months of gloss and water beading in Texas heat.
